Web15 sep. 2010 · Sufism is the inward-looking, mystical dimension of Islam, emphasizing personal and emotional religious experiences. The theological orientation of Sufism, with its inward focus on spirituality, is such that its followers generally tend to shy away from more politicized forms of Islam.
